Here is the line you want to include in the WinMySQLAdmin section of the My.ini file. Change the path to suit your installation. [WinMySQLAdmin] Server=C:/mySQL/bin/mysqld-max-nt.exe

All mysql server varieties are included in the mysql installer, and zip archive. Look in the mysql 'bin' dir for 'mysqld-max-nt'.
